NEW DELHI, Nov. 19 (APP) Indian
Air Force Vice Chief Air Marshal P K Barbora while complaining against Indian
political class for playing politics on military requirements said “as far as
defence goes, we don’t even match up with Pakistan.”Playing politics over
defence purchases impinged “very badly” on the country’s military requirements,”
he told a CII seminar on energising aviation sector in India.
P K Barbora while expressing
dissatisfaction also about India’s Defence exports said, “as far as defence
goes, we don’t even match up with Pakistan.”“The internal politics over the
years is such that whatever defence requirements are cleared by the government,
they are opposed by the opposition parties and the same happens when roles
change and opposition sits in government, “ he said.
Barbora’s observations on
Tuesday about recruitment of women pilots in IAF also generated heated debate in
the media.
He had said “they may be
recruited as fighter pilots provided they do not become mother till a certain
age.” He also suggested that having woman pilots in IAF may be a bad investment
for the government.
Today, he said he did not mean
that what had been debated in the media over his remarks saying those were his
personal views and not the policy of the Ministry of Defence.
